Transaction 334cdb86fbb32fcc770d9115a4e3e368c12a496da598019e74c4aa0503cd2a67

1 Input
2 Outputs
  • 334cdb86fbb32fcc770d9115a4e3e368c12a496da598019e74c4aa0503cd2a67:0
  • value  3307000
    address  3BMEXZXYBf8MHZs3jXWhXFM2PSwNmV8SCF
  • 334cdb86fbb32fcc770d9115a4e3e368c12a496da598019e74c4aa0503cd2a67:1
  • value  25687825
    address  12xbM5BsAZgskdNx61ZoJL3AntN7MCu4qh